profile-img

Kareem Khaled Mohllal

Software Engineer

Maadi, Cairo, Egypt

Work Experience

  • Software EngineerFull Time

    Bosta

    Dec 2019 - Present -5 yrs, 6 months

    Egypt , Cairo

    • Job Details:Responsibilities: - Collaborated in developing and revamping the real-time Meteor back-end server to a RESTful APIs Express.js server. - Collaborated in moving the DigitalOcean VM based infrastructure to the Google Kubernetes Engine (GKE). - Responsible for automating the deployment process for different environments using CI/CD best practices. - Owned the production releases.
  • Back-End Software EngineerFull Time

    AlgorithmZ –Tooli

    Feb 2019 - Dec 2019 -10 months

    Egypt , Cairo

    • Job Details:Responsibilities: - Collaborated in developing and maintaining web services for a Microservices architectured IPTV application. - Collaborated in designing and building a video-on-demand management system through which the VOD providers can publish their content to end-users. - Responsible for revamping the subscription management system to optimize its overall performance and meet new business requirements and changes. - Responsible for releases' deployments to multiple Google Compute Engine and Microsoft Azure VMs.
  • Co-Founder & Software EngineerFull Time

    Salfny

    Jan 2017 - Sep 2017 -8 months

    Egypt , Assiut

    • Job Details:Responsibilities: - Developed the company’s culture and the overall vision. - Analyzed problematic situations and occurrences and provided solutions to ensure the company survival and growth. - Documented and demonstrated technical solutions by developing mockups, flowcharts, layouts, and diagrams. - Participated with other team members in designing user-friendly web interfaces, developing high-quality object-oriented business objects, and conducting research of web technologies and techniques.
  • Education

    • BSc in Computer Science

      Assiut University (AUN)

      Jan 2013 - Jan 2017 - 4 yr

    • High School - Thanaweya Amma

      Gamal Farghaly Sultan

      Jan 2012 

    Activities

    • Technical Team Lead at IEEE Student Branch - Assiut University

      Volunteering

      Sep 2014 - Sep 2015 -1 yr

    Achievements

    Winner of the 13th round of StartIT business plan competition.

    Verified Badges

    Technical Badges:

      Skills

      • Object Oriented Programming
      • JSON
      • MySQL
      • SQLite
      • REST
      • Jinja2
      • Git
      • Node.js
      • Docker
      • Redis
      View More

      Languages

      • Arabic

        Fluent
      • English

        Advanced

      Training & Certifications

      • Architecting with Google Kubernetes Engine Specialization

        Coursera·2020
      • Object-Oriented Design

        Coursera·2020
      • Cloud Developer Nanodegree

        Udacity·2020
      • Server-side Development with NodeJS

        Coursera·2017
      • Full Stack Web Developer Nanodegree

        Udacity·2017
      • Front-End JavaScript Frameworks: AngularJS

        Coursera·2017
      • Front-End Web UI Frameworks and Tools

        Coursera·2016
      • HTML, CSS and JavaScript

        Coursera·2016
      Share this Profile